FN - 352 Multinational Financial Management

Credits: 3

Focuses on international economic issues that impact on multinational firms. Particular emphasis is on managing risk caused by exchange rate, political, economic, and accounting differences between countries. The analysis and development of financial, operating, and marketing strategies to minimize the impact on the firm caused by these risk elements is a major component of the course.

Prerequisite(s): FN 330  or FN 331
